To do this, it is necessary not only to achieve remission or low activity, but also to successfully control the main, most painful, manifestations of the disease. Therefore, when evaluating the results of RA treatment, the dynamics of not only standard indices (DAS28 (Disease Activity Score 28), CDAI (Clinical Disease Activity Index), SDAI (Simplified Disease Activity Index)), but also the so-called “patient reported outcomes” (PRO) – a patient’s global assessment of disease activity (PGA), pain, functional disorders and fatigue.</p><p>This review examines the effect of one of the main classes of anti–rheumatic drugs - biological disease-modifying antirheumatic drugs (bDMARDs) on the PROs. The results of a series of randomized controlled trials are presented, in which changes in PROs were studied using various tumor necrosis factor α (TNF-α) inhibitors, abatacept T-lymphocyte co-stimulation inhibitor, rituximab CD20 inhibitor and interleukin (IL) 6 inhibitors.</p><p>The use of bDMARDs in combination with methotrexate (MTX) provides a reduction in PGA and pain by 50-60%, functional disorders according to HAQ (Health Assessment Questionnaire) and fatigue according to FACIT-F (Functional Assessment of Chronic Illness Therapy – Fatigue) – by 15-30%. B DMARDs monotherapy (with the exception of the effect of tocilizumab on HAQ) does not exceed MTX monotherapy in its effect on PROs. Monotherapy with tocilizumab provides more favorable dynamics of PGA and pain than monotherapy with TNF-α inhibitors. An important advantage of IL-6 inhibitors is the rapid achievement of a clinical effect, which is noted already in the first 2 weeks after the first administration of the drug. </p></trans-abstract><kwd-group xml:lang="ru"><kwd>генно-инженерные биологические препараты</kwd><kwd>ревматоидный артрит</kwd><kwd>боль</kwd><kwd>нарушение функции</kwd><kwd>усталость</kwd><kwd>качество жизни</kwd></kwd-group><kwd-group xml:lang="en"><kwd>biological disease-modifying antirheumatic drugs</kwd><kwd>rheumatoid arthritis</kwd><kwd>pain</kwd><kwd>dysfunction</kwd><kwd>fatigue</kwd><kwd>quality of life</kwd></kwd-group><funding-group><funding-statement xml:lang="ru">Работа выполнена в рамках фундаментальной научной тематики «Разработка персонализированной программы лечения рефрактерного ревматоидного артрита на основе изучения молекулярно-генетических и молекулярно-биологических предикторов.
